Путь в ИТ. Елена Правдина
Вам придется в первую очередь воспитывать вчерашних студентов или перекраивать под нужды продукта вновь пришедших более опытных разработчиков. Техлидов редко нанимают: ими не приходят – ими становятся лучшие гибриды профессионала и руководителя. Вы староста группы, с легкостью входите в командную работу и эффективно советуете, как разделиться, чтобы выиграть? Тогда вам стоит взращивать эти качества и дальше. Легко находите выход из спорных ситуаций, сохраняя хорошие отношения с обеими сторонами?
Вы должны вызывать естественную веру людей в ваши знания. Каждый двоечник с трепетом подходит за помощью к отличнику, цепляясь как за соломинку за возможность списать. Он верит – там будут верные ответы и полученная информация спасет его от неминуемого провала. Точно так же разработчики потянутся к техлиду, когда его решения верны: совет ускорил реализацию фичи, упростил поддержку в дальнейшем, просветил о неизвестном методе, вызвал «вау-эффект» у пользователей и благосклонность начальства. Такой человек – умеющий принимать верные многофакторные решения – станет настоящим техлидом. Истина – она либо одна, либо внушаема. Учитесь видеть единую правду или убеждать в ней остальных. Или же – оставьте попытки стать тем, кем являться не в силах, и смиренно листайте дальше.
Техлид или руководитель группы всегда хранит в себе чуткость к межличностным отношениям. Способность понимать, что движет каждым, – фундамент успеха в этой роли. Важно уметь дать мотиватор любому – желанный ли проект, новую ли обязанность – всё индивидуально, но обязано быть ведомым и контролируемым фактором, иначе человек уйдет.
Лучший носитель данного портрета исследует психологию, учится общаться и ладить с людьми, находит компромиссы между технической и полезной для продукта составляющими. Он немного политик, готов пойти на риск, не боится где-то слукавить или нарушить правила, но так, что будет во благо и допустимо лишь потому, что сами правила не так гибки, как того требует ситуация.
Помню, однажды мне предложили выкатить релиз, заведомо содержащий довольно ощутимые баги. Первая реакция – непонимание: шутка, диверсия? Разрыв шаблона для разработчика – как может подняться рука отправить в продакшен очевидно сбойный код? Но у столь смелого предложения был свой расчет: перед выкладкой приложение тщательно ревьюилось и почти всегда возвращалось на доработку в силу бюрократического и слабо детерминированного процесса в сфере тогдашнего Smart TV. Объем изменений релиза был велик, а вероятность возврата – высока, в то же время было важно соблюсти срок сдачи для заказчика. А значит, мы могли отдать на апрув приложение уже сегодня, продолжить доработки, а затем внести их в продукт с прочими мелкими замечаниями, после почти гарантированного возврата. Тем самым ускорив попадание релиза к потребителям в конечном итоге. Ловкость ума и никакого мошенничества.
Я встречала немало крутых технических лидеров